Cynthia Slaughterbeck was a nurse
Cynthia Slaughterbeck, Age 67, of Bradenton, Fla., passed away at Traditions of Lebanon in Lebanon, Ohio, on Sunday, May 5, 2024 following an extended illness.
She was preceded in death by her husband, Steve Slaughterbeck, father, Ned Kress and brother, Brad Kress. She was a 1974 Graduate of Franklin-Monroe High School.
She had a heart to serve and did so as a nurse for over 30 years both in Ohio and in Florida. She was very active in promoting and playing shuffleboard. She served as the President of the Florida Shuffleboard Association’s Southwest District.
Cynthia is survived by three sons, Craig, Andrew & Scott Slaughterbeck; mother, Janice Kress; grandchildren, Alessandro, Matthew, Nora, June, Malachi, Genevieve and Trey; sisters, Valerie Beighle and Brenda Brooks and numerous other relatives and friends.
Graveside services will be held 11:00 a.m. on Tuesday, May 14 at Newcomer Cemetery north of Pitsburg, where she will be buried with her husband, Steve.
